Elderly shower installation services involve modifying or replacing existing bathroom showers to enhance safety, accessibility, and convenience for seniors. These services typically include installing walk-in showers, low-threshold or curbless designs, grab bars, and seating options to reduce the risk of slips and falls. The goal is to create a bathroom environment that is easier to use and safer for individuals with limited mobility or balance concerns, helping to promote independence and comfort in daily routines.
This type of installation addresses common problems such as difficulty stepping over high tub walls, unstable footing, and the lack of supportive features in standard showers. Elderly shower upgrades can eliminate hazards associated with traditional bathroom setups, such as slippery surfaces or inaccessible entry points. By integrating safety features and ergonomic designs, these services help reduce the likelihood of accidents and provide peace of mind for both seniors and their caregivers.

Installation Costs - The cost for elderly shower installation services typically ranges from $1,000 to $3,500, depending on the complexity and features selected. Basic installations may be closer to $1,000, while custom or walk-in showers can exceed $3,000.
Material Expenses - The price of materials such as accessible shower bases, grab bars, and non-slip flooring can add $500 to $2,000 to the overall project. Higher-end finishes and specialized fixtures tend to increase costs further.
Labor Fees - Labor charges for installing elderly-friendly showers generally fall between $500 and $2,000. The total depends on the existing bathroom setup and the extent of modifications required.
Additional Costs - Additional expenses may include plumbing adjustments, permits, or structural modifications, which can range from $200 to $1,000. These costs vary based on the scope of work and local contractor rates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
